WebAug 20, 2024 · In short, no. An S corporation is a tax treatment election reserved exclusively for for-profit endeavors. To briefly break down the for-profit corporate options: with the state, you can either file an LLC or … WebOct 19, 2024 · A not-for-profit corporation can make a “profit” as long as it is reinvested to support the not-for-profit purposes of the corporation. Not-for-profit corporations can have commercial activities but if any of the purposes are of a commercial nature, the corporation’s articles must state that the purpose is intended to advance or support ...
